Transaction f49b8143103fa48a269441d1bdb8b1549591df552a1f2071a0d707923387d182

131 Input
2 Outputs
  • f49b8143103fa48a269441d1bdb8b1549591df552a1f2071a0d707923387d182:0
  • value  596106863
    address  3JneRN6RU8X76VRTJc2uVyufX6BvBR8Aa3
  • f49b8143103fa48a269441d1bdb8b1549591df552a1f2071a0d707923387d182:1
  • value  949247
    address  3HQGpwuEB6iw5uSctFUeZJxuQy4pq2Va4q